📖 Biography

Mr. Herriman is an elderly anthropomorphic rabbit imaginary friend created by Madame Foster when she was a child. He serves as the business manager of Foster's Home for Imaginary Friends and takes his responsibility for rules, order, and proper conduct extremely seriously. His rigid personality frequently puts him at odds with Bloo and Frankie, but beneath his stern exterior he is deeply loyal to Madame Foster and cares about the home. His formal manners, distinctive English accent, and old-fashioned appearance make him one of the show's most recognizable characters.

⚡ Fun Facts

  • 01 Mr. Herriman was imagined by Madame Foster when she was a child.
  • 02 He wears a tailcoat, top hat, white gloves, and monocle, giving him a distinctly old-fashioned appearance.
  • 03 Mr. Herriman has an intense fear of dogs because rabbits are natural prey for them.
  • 04 He has a strong fondness for carrots, reflecting his rabbit nature.
  • 05 He once created a lullaby called “Funny Bunny” for the young Madame Foster, much to his later embarrassment.
  • 06 Mr. Herriman is especially strict with Bloo because Bloo is allowed to remain at Foster's despite still having an owner.
